Transaction 309c07e2830f41b04f675d8a76ac8c09b248e2b6603a5215c981654c4e0444c6
1 Input
1 Output
-
309c07e2830f41b04f675d8a76ac8c09b248e2b6603a5215c981654c4e0444c6:0
- value
- 104751882
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c089a0f0b549553bbadd51d8559eff9176c69e06 OP_EQUAL
- address
- 3KF4XyyB3zHvsirUopMmszG2vmiXsHKTwr